Revision tags: php-7.3.13RC1, php-7.2.26RC1, php-7.4.0, php-7.2.25, php-7.3.12, php-7.4.0RC6 |
|
#
5fa6dcd9 |
| 07-Nov-2019 |
Nikita Popov |
Fixed bug #78759 Handle INDIRECT values in array.
|
Revision tags: php-7.3.12RC1, php-7.2.25RC1, php-7.4.0RC5, php-7.1.33, php-7.2.24, php-7.3.11, php-7.4.0RC4, php-7.3.11RC1, php-7.2.24RC1, php-7.4.0RC3, php-7.2.23, php-7.3.10, php-7.4.0RC2, php-7.2.23RC1, php-7.3.10RC1, php-7.4.0RC1, php-7.1.32, php-7.2.22, php-7.3.9, php-7.4.0beta4, php-7.2.22RC1, php-7.3.9RC1, php-7.4.0beta2, php-7.1.31, php-7.2.21, php-7.3.8, php-7.4.0beta1, php-7.2.21RC1, php-7.3.8RC1, php-7.4.0alpha3, php-7.3.7, php-7.2.20, php-7.4.0alpha2, php-7.3.7RC3, php-7.3.7RC2, php-7.2.20RC2, php-7.4.0alpha1, php-7.3.7RC1, php-7.2.20RC1 |
|
#
83cdb89f |
| 07-Jun-2019 |
Dmitry Stogov |
Fixed bug #77135 (Extract with EXTR_SKIP should skip $this)
|
Revision tags: php-7.2.19, php-7.3.6, php-7.1.30, php-7.2.19RC1, php-7.3.6RC1, php-7.1.29, php-7.2.18, php-7.3.5, php-7.2.18RC1, php-7.3.5RC1, php-7.2.17, php-7.3.4, php-7.1.28, php-7.3.4RC1, php-7.2.17RC1, php-7.1.27, php-7.3.3, php-7.2.16 |
|
#
9ad9cc71 |
| 28-Feb-2019 |
Nikita Popov |
Fixed bug #77669
|
Revision tags: php-7.3.3RC1, php-7.2.16RC1, php-7.2.15, php-7.3.2, php-7.2.15RC1, php-7.3.2RC1, php-5.6.40, php-7.1.26, php-7.3.1, php-7.2.14 |
|
#
8ebae846 |
| 02-Jan-2019 |
Xinchen Hui |
Fixed bug #77395 (segfault about array_multisort)
|
Revision tags: php-7.2.14RC1, php-7.3.1RC1, php-5.6.39, php-7.1.25, php-7.2.13, php-7.0.33, php-7.3.0, php-7.1.25RC1, php-7.2.13RC1, php-7.3.0RC6, php-7.1.24, php-7.2.12, php-7.3.0RC5, php-7.1.24RC1, php-7.2.12RC1, php-7.3.0RC4, php-7.1.23, php-7.2.11, php-7.3.0RC3, php-7.1.23RC1, php-7.2.11RC1, php-7.3.0RC2, php-5.6.38, php-7.1.22, php-7.3.0RC1, php-7.2.10, php-7.0.32, php-7.1.22RC1, php-7.3.0beta3, php-7.2.10RC1, php-7.1.21, php-7.2.9, php-7.3.0beta2, php-7.1.21RC1, php-7.3.0beta1, php-7.2.9RC1, php-5.6.37, php-7.1.20, php-7.3.0alpha4, php-7.0.31, php-7.2.8, php-7.1.20RC1, php-7.2.8RC1, php-7.3.0alpha3, php-7.3.0alpha2, php-7.1.19, php-7.2.7, php-7.1.19RC1, php-7.3.0alpha1, php-7.2.7RC1, php-7.1.18, php-7.2.6, php-7.2.6RC1, php-7.1.18RC1, php-5.6.36, php-7.2.5, php-7.1.17, php-7.0.30, php-7.1.17RC1, php-7.2.5RC1, php-5.6.35, php-7.0.29, php-7.2.4, php-7.1.16, php-7.1.16RC1, php-7.2.4RC1, php-7.1.15, php-5.6.34, php-7.2.3, php-7.0.28, php-7.2.3RC1, php-7.1.15RC1, php-7.1.14, php-7.2.2, php-7.1.14RC1, php-7.2.2RC1, php-7.1.13, php-5.6.33, php-7.2.1, php-7.0.27, php-7.2.1RC1, php-7.1.13RC1, php-7.0.27RC1, php-7.2.0, php-7.1.12 |
|
#
ab6c45f5 |
| 22-Nov-2017 |
Manabu Matsui |
Fix bug #75533: array_reduce is slow when $carry is large array
|
#
70b2fca2 |
| 22-Aug-2018 |
Christoph M. Becker |
Fix #76778: array_reduce leaks memory if callback throws exception We have to release the result variable in the error case, too.
|
#
38d97557 |
| 24-Jul-2018 |
Xinchen Hui |
Fixed bug #68553 (array_column: null values in $index_key become incrementing keys in result)
|
#
6531719d |
| 21-Jun-2018 |
Xinchen Hui |
Fixed bug #76505 (array_merge_recursive() is duplicating sub-array keys)
|
#
951e29f6 |
| 05-Jun-2018 |
Xinchen Hui |
Fixed bug #76410 (SIGV in zend_mm_alloc_small)
|
#
73bf2385 |
| 05-Jun-2018 |
Stanislav Malyshev |
Fix bug #76390 - do not allow invalid strings in range()
|
#
97a84831 |
| 27-May-2018 |
Bob Weinand |
Fixed bug #76383 (array_map on $GLOBALS returns IS_INDIRECT)
|
#
bb79e576 |
| 25-Mar-2018 |
Gabriel Caruso |
Fix arginfo for array_replace(_recursive) and array_merge(_recursive)
|
#
fd5bd37a |
| 05-Mar-2018 |
Nikita Popov |
Revert "Fixed bug #75961 (Strange references behavior)" This reverts commit 94e9d0a2ae76bad712495d820d3962e401085fef. This code needs to be mindful about modifications to the array
Revert "Fixed bug #75961 (Strange references behavior)" This reverts commit 94e9d0a2ae76bad712495d820d3962e401085fef. This code needs to be mindful about modifications to the array happening during callback execution. It was written in a way that only accessed the reference, which is guaranteed not to move. The changed implementation instead accesses the array slot, leading to use-after-free. Run ext/standard/tests/array/bug61967.phpt under valgrind to see the issue.
show more ...
|
#
94e9d0a2 |
| 17-Feb-2018 |
Xinchen Hui |
Fixed bug #75961 (Strange references behavior)
|
#
8c73fc80 |
| 12-Jan-2018 |
Nikita Popov |
Fixed bug #75653
|
#
7a7ec01a |
| 02-Jan-2018 |
Xinchen Hui |
year++
|
#
ccd4716e |
| 02-Jan-2018 |
Xinchen Hui |
year++
|
Revision tags: php-7.0.26, php-7.1.12RC1, php-7.2.0RC6, php-7.0.26RC1 |
|
#
cc96166f |
| 27-Oct-2017 |
Sara Golemon |
Don't optimize input arrays with suffix holes
|
Revision tags: php-7.1.11, php-5.6.32, php-7.2.0RC5, php-7.0.25, php-7.1.11RC1, php-7.2.0RC4, php-7.0.25RC1, php-7.1.10, php-7.2.0RC3, php-7.0.24, php-7.2.0RC2, php-7.1.10RC1, php-7.0.24RC1, php-7.1.9, php-7.2.0RC1, php-7.0.23, php-7.1.9RC1, php-7.2.0beta3, php-7.0.23RC1, php-7.1.8, php-7.2.0beta2 |
|
#
6c2c7a02 |
| 01-Aug-2017 |
Nikita Popov |
Optimize array_unique() In SORT_STRING mode, instead of sorting the array, build a hash of seen elements.
|
Revision tags: php-7.0.22, php-7.1.8RC1, php-7.2.0beta1, php-7.0.22RC1, php-5.6.31, php-7.0.21, php-7.1.7, php-7.2.0alpha3 |
|
#
5a51da99 |
| 29-Jun-2017 |
Dmitry Stogov |
Use inlined version of zval_ptr_dtor() in array_map() loop
|
#
04fb3f28 |
| 25-Jun-2017 |
Tom Van Looy |
Remove superfluous semicolons
|
Revision tags: php-7.1.7RC1, php-7.0.21RC1, php-7.2.0alpha2 |
|
#
9c2a1f52 |
| 19-Jun-2017 |
Dmitry Stogov |
Avoid useless dereferences and separations during paramter passing.
|
#
ace9fe53 |
| 08-Jun-2017 |
Dmitry Stogov |
Improved new Zend Parameter Parsing API to avoid useless dereferences. This derefernce made sense only for explicit paramter passing by reference, but this feature was removed in PHP-7. The i
Improved new Zend Parameter Parsing API to avoid useless dereferences. This derefernce made sense only for explicit paramter passing by reference, but this feature was removed in PHP-7. The improvement is 100% backward compatible, only few "tricky" functions may be affected (e.g. extract and usort).
show more ...
|
Revision tags: php-7.1.6, php-7.2.0alpha1, php-7.0.20 |
|
#
27e7aea4 |
| 25-May-2017 |
Dmitry Stogov |
"Countable" interface is moved from SPL to Core
|
Revision tags: php-7.1.6RC1, php-7.0.20RC1 |
|
#
a08723d3 |
| 18-May-2017 |
Dmitry Stogov |
Use interned empty and "one char" strings.
|